Med/Surg | Registered Nurse | 13-Week Travel RN Contract – Roanoke Rapids, NC Travel Registered Nurse (RN) – Medical/Surgical (Med/Surg) Assignment in Roanoke Rapids, North Carolina

Travel RN opportunity in Roanoke Rapids, NC: join a collaborative Medical/Surgical nursing team, expand your acute care experience, and work with EPIC charting in a supportive eastern North Carolina healthcare setting.

  • Setting: Medical/Surgical unit
  • Employment Type: Travel Registered Nurse
  • Start Date: 08/24/2026
  • End Date: 11/24/2026
  • Duration: 13 weeks
  • Weekly

    Hours:

    36 hours per week
  • Estimated Weekly Pay: $1,680 - $1,770
  • Charting System: EPIC
  • Patient Ratio: Approximately 1:5-6
  • Unit Size: 36 beds/cases
  • Travel Rule: 80-mile radius rule applies
Job Requirements
  • Active Registered Nurse (RN) license; compact RN license accepted
  • Minimum 2 years of Med/Surg or related acute care nursing experience
  • BLS certification from the American Heart Association (AHA)
  • Strong teamwork, adaptability, and excellent bedside nursing skills
  • Experience assisting providers with bedside procedures
  • Comfort working with common Medical/Surgical diagnoses and post-op patients
Responsibilities
  • Provide safe, high-quality care to general Medical/Surgical patients with varied acuity
  • Monitor patient conditions, document accurately in EPIC, and communicate changes promptly
  • Assist with bedside procedures and support providers as needed
  • Manage common Med/Surg conditions such as COPD exacerbation, sepsis, pneumonia, stroke, renal failure, and post-op recovery
  • Perform and support care involving chest tubes, central lines, tracheostomy care, CPAP/BiPAP, wound vacs, and more as appropriate
  • Administer medications and therapies safely, including IV medications and drips per unit protocol
  • Collaborate with charge nurses, nursing assistants, and ancillary staff to deliver team-based patient care
  • Float to other nursing areas as needed based on census and skill set
